Okay - my wife has an 2003 Hugger 883, 100th Anniversary.

(yeah, yeah, I know - and I'm buying these condoms for my buddy).

Anyways, she had the buckhorn bars on it (bleah) and I'm in the process of putting on a normal set. Not flat bars, or beach bars, just the standard set of bars with a mild rise & angle.

Does anyone have HD part numbers for the clutch line & brake line? The throttle cables are fine, but the clutch line is way too long, and the metal portion of the brake line prevents its' use.

What kind of bars and risers are you planning on using?? I have an 883L and put 6+1/2 inch pullbackrisers (Drag Specialties) and NightTrain OEM Dragbars on mine and I did not need to change any of my wires or cables.
